diff options
Diffstat (limited to 'PC/clinic/msvcrtmodule.c.h')
-rw-r--r-- | PC/clinic/msvcrtmodule.c.h | 42 |
1 files changed, 41 insertions, 1 deletions
diff --git a/PC/clinic/msvcrtmodule.c.h b/PC/clinic/msvcrtmodule.c.h index d808ef0bbd..b708c6cdde 100644 --- a/PC/clinic/msvcrtmodule.c.h +++ b/PC/clinic/msvcrtmodule.c.h @@ -261,6 +261,8 @@ msvcrt_getch(PyObject *module, PyObject *Py_UNUSED(ignored)) return return_value; } +#if defined(MS_WINDOWS_DESKTOP) + PyDoc_STRVAR(msvcrt_getwch__doc__, "getwch($module, /)\n" "--\n" @@ -285,6 +287,8 @@ msvcrt_getwch(PyObject *module, PyObject *Py_UNUSED(ignored)) return return_value; } +#endif /* defined(MS_WINDOWS_DESKTOP) */ + PyDoc_STRVAR(msvcrt_getche__doc__, "getche($module, /)\n" "--\n" @@ -309,6 +313,8 @@ msvcrt_getche(PyObject *module, PyObject *Py_UNUSED(ignored)) return return_value; } +#if defined(MS_WINDOWS_DESKTOP) + PyDoc_STRVAR(msvcrt_getwche__doc__, "getwche($module, /)\n" "--\n" @@ -333,6 +339,8 @@ msvcrt_getwche(PyObject *module, PyObject *Py_UNUSED(ignored)) return return_value; } +#endif /* defined(MS_WINDOWS_DESKTOP) */ + PyDoc_STRVAR(msvcrt_putch__doc__, "putch($module, char, /)\n" "--\n" @@ -367,6 +375,8 @@ exit: return return_value; } +#if defined(MS_WINDOWS_DESKTOP) + PyDoc_STRVAR(msvcrt_putwch__doc__, "putwch($module, unicode_char, /)\n" "--\n" @@ -403,6 +413,8 @@ exit: return return_value; } +#endif /* defined(MS_WINDOWS_DESKTOP) */ + PyDoc_STRVAR(msvcrt_ungetch__doc__, "ungetch($module, char, /)\n" "--\n" @@ -441,6 +453,8 @@ exit: return return_value; } +#if defined(MS_WINDOWS_DESKTOP) + PyDoc_STRVAR(msvcrt_ungetwch__doc__, "ungetwch($module, unicode_char, /)\n" "--\n" @@ -477,6 +491,8 @@ exit: return return_value; } +#endif /* defined(MS_WINDOWS_DESKTOP) */ + #if defined(_DEBUG) PyDoc_STRVAR(msvcrt_CrtSetReportFile__doc__, @@ -610,6 +626,8 @@ exit: #endif /* defined(_DEBUG) */ +#if (defined(MS_WINDOWS_DESKTOP) || defined(MS_WINDOWS_APP) || defined(MS_WINDOWS_SYSTEM)) + PyDoc_STRVAR(msvcrt_GetErrorMode__doc__, "GetErrorMode($module, /)\n" "--\n" @@ -628,6 +646,8 @@ msvcrt_GetErrorMode(PyObject *module, PyObject *Py_UNUSED(ignored)) return msvcrt_GetErrorMode_impl(module); } +#endif /* (defined(MS_WINDOWS_DESKTOP) || defined(MS_WINDOWS_APP) || defined(MS_WINDOWS_SYSTEM)) */ + PyDoc_STRVAR(msvcrt_SetErrorMode__doc__, "SetErrorMode($module, mode, /)\n" "--\n" @@ -656,6 +676,22 @@ exit: return return_value; } +#ifndef MSVCRT_GETWCH_METHODDEF + #define MSVCRT_GETWCH_METHODDEF +#endif /* !defined(MSVCRT_GETWCH_METHODDEF) */ + +#ifndef MSVCRT_GETWCHE_METHODDEF + #define MSVCRT_GETWCHE_METHODDEF +#endif /* !defined(MSVCRT_GETWCHE_METHODDEF) */ + +#ifndef MSVCRT_PUTWCH_METHODDEF + #define MSVCRT_PUTWCH_METHODDEF +#endif /* !defined(MSVCRT_PUTWCH_METHODDEF) */ + +#ifndef MSVCRT_UNGETWCH_METHODDEF + #define MSVCRT_UNGETWCH_METHODDEF +#endif /* !defined(MSVCRT_UNGETWCH_METHODDEF) */ + #ifndef MSVCRT_CRTSETREPORTFILE_METHODDEF #define MSVCRT_CRTSETREPORTFILE_METHODDEF #endif /* !defined(MSVCRT_CRTSETREPORTFILE_METHODDEF) */ @@ -667,4 +703,8 @@ exit: #ifndef MSVCRT_SET_ERROR_MODE_METHODDEF #define MSVCRT_SET_ERROR_MODE_METHODDEF #endif /* !defined(MSVCRT_SET_ERROR_MODE_METHODDEF) */ -/*[clinic end generated code: output=204bae9fee7f6124 input=a9049054013a1b77]*/ + +#ifndef MSVCRT_GETERRORMODE_METHODDEF + #define MSVCRT_GETERRORMODE_METHODDEF +#endif /* !defined(MSVCRT_GETERRORMODE_METHODDEF) */ +/*[clinic end generated code: output=2db6197608a6aab3 input=a9049054013a1b77]*/ |